CHEESY MINI BURGERS



Cheesy Mini Burgers image

I love these cute little bite-sized burgers. They are excellent for parties, and football gatherings and always go down a storm with the men folk! Great for children's parties too! These can be prepared up to a day before hand, then assembled and grilled.

Provided by Noo8820

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 35m

Yield 24 burgers

Number Of Ingredients 10

6 slices bread
60 g melted butter
1 tablespoon tomato paste
1/3 cup grated cheese
250 g minced beef
1 small onion, chopped
1/2 teaspoon French mustard
1/2 teaspoon tomato sauce
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 tablespoon oil

Steps:

  • For the patties:.
  • Combine mince,onion,mustard and sauces in a bowl.
  • Take two teaspoonfuls and shape into a ball, and then flatten slightly to form a patty. Repeat with all of the mixture.
  • Cut 4 1/2 cm rounds from each slice of bread, 4 out of each slice. Brush with melted butter and bake in a moderate oven for approx 15 minutes, until lightly browned and crisp.
  • Spread each round with tomato paste.
  • Heat oil in a large fry pan. Cook patties until well browned; drain on kitchen towel.
  • Place patties on top of the bread rounds and top with cheese.
  • Grill until the cheese has melted.

CHEESY MINI-BURGERS



Cheesy Mini-Burgers image

Enjoy mini burgers-AKA garlicky meatballs! Whatever you call them, there's one thing we know: these Cheesy Mini Burgers are great on white rice or slider buns!

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     1 Bag, 5 Dinners

Time 30m

Yield Makes 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 lb. lean ground beef
1 cup KRAFT Shredded Cheddar Cheese, divided
1/2 cup HEINZ Tomato Ketchup, divided
1/2 tsp. garlic powder
2-2/3 cups hot cooked instant white rice

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400°F.
  • Mix meat, 2/3 cup cheese, 1/4 cup ketchup and garlic powder; shape into 12 balls. Place, 4-inches apart, on foil-covered baking sheet sprayed with cooking spray; flatten each into 1/2-inch-thick patty.
  • Bake 15 min. or until done (160ºF); drain.
  • Spread patties with remaining ketchup. Top with remaining cheese; bake 5 min. or until melted. Serve over rice.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 420, Fat 17 g, SaturatedFat 9 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 75 mg, Sodium 500 mg, Carbohydrate 39 g, Fiber 1 g, Sugar 6 g, Protein 25 g
